Former speaker of the U.S. House of Representatives Newt Gingrich visited NIH on June 20. He met with NIH director Dr. Francis Collins in Bldg. 1 before touring the Clinical Center with CC CEO Dr. James Gilman. 

While in the CC, Gingrich sat in on a science briefing with researchers at the National Eye Institute, including NEI director Dr. Paul Sieving and clinical director Dr. Brian Brooks. Sieving gave Gingrich an overview of the institute and research under way. 

Then, NEI Stadtman investigator Dr. Kapil Bharti of the unit on ocular stem cells and translational research gave a slide presentation on the latest developments in his regenerative medicine and stem cell research. Gingrich was able to see elements of the science first-hand, visiting Bharti’s lab and viewing cell cultures via microscope.
